Description
The cattle pound at High Ellerbeck Bridge is an early 19th-century structure made of calciferous sandstone rubble. It features a low drystone wall with a mix of large and small stone coping, which encloses a small, roughly rectangular area situated between a field and the former road that led to a ford over the river. Although it is now disused and overgrown, this cattle pound is a rare survival in the area.
